Evident Scientific, Inc. is a precision manufacturing leader creating of large Bar and Tube inspection systems utilizing UT and EC Inspection solutions for a variety of manufacturing industries. Our employees work every day providing product and software solutions that help customers increase manufacturing productivity and maintain capital equipment and facilities. Our product solutions include Eddy Current and Ultrasonic Testing Systems. Our Field Service Specialist NDT Integrations products are technical experts and solution providers that are very good at supporting customers and sales representatives. Our non-destructive testing instruments are used to inspect critical equipment in a variety of production line environments in a variety of industries. You will spend time creating and supporting customized product solutions using Evident Scientific hardware software and manufacturing capabilities. You will also be in the field providing your expertise before during and after the sale. You must be able to manage your time and the fast-paced workload in this sales environment. This is an after-sales support role that will have an impact on the company results. Evident Scientific products are well known within key industries that require high quality high value and reliable instrumentation for their critical applications. Job Duties
- Provide product training to customers and internal personnel on the NDT integration hardware and software solutions.
- Meet with customers to provide technical information and create systems specifications used to create a scope of work for internal staff.
- Provide product feedback to the manufacturing centers for current product improvements and future product designs.
- Support to customers for installation problems and issues with broken equipment.
- Required to travel to perform on-site repair of defective systems or remotely aid customers with their repairs.
- Diagnose equipment problems and establish contact with the customer.
- Repair defective material in the workshop on site or remotely (ensure connectivity for remote maintenance).
- Take part in the 24/7 days a week customer-support program rotation.
- Participate in maintenance programs and the proposal of spare parts.
- Negotiate with and manage subcontractors when necessary.
- Provide customized training to users.
- Proactively provide expert level technical advice and support to customers and field sales personnel regarding NDT hardware software and systems integration products.

Job Requirements
Education:
- Bachelor's degree in computer science physics engineering or other technical discipline or equivalent experience.
Experience:
- 3+ years of experience developing, integrating, or supporting industrial applications related to NDT or automated manufacturing systems.
- 3+ years of experience managing or assisting with installation projects in industrial environments, involving integrated software and hardware systems used to automate manufacturing processes.
Competencies:
•Ability to configure software and hardware solutions for automating industrial machinery.
•Ability to understand how industrial machinery and manufacturing works to be able to solve customer application problems.
•Must be able to travel approximately 50% of the time in the territory.
•Solid working knowledge of electronics personal computer hardware software and LAN (Microsoft) concepts.
•Proven history of success in a business-to-business environment.
•Ability to create and deliver clear and concise presentations product demonstrations and emails to various audiences.
•Must be self-directed highly motivated and business oriented.
Pay Range: $86,000.00 - $117,000.00 a year plus bonus-depending on experience.

Who are we?
Wabtec is a leading global provider of equipment, systems, digital solutions, and value-added services for the freight and transit rail sectors. Drawing on more than 150 years of experience, we are leading the way in safety, efficiency, reliability, innovation, and productivity. Whether it’s freight, transit, ports, logistics, mining, industrial, or marine, our expertise, technologies, and people together – are accelerating the future of transportation. With roots that date back to George Westinghouse, Thomas Edison, and Louis Faiveley, Wabtec has always built technologies and implemented solutions for a variety of sectors that are critical to meeting the needs of customers and governments alike.
Our global team of about 30,000 employees worldwide delivers performance that moves the world forward. We’re lifelong learners, obsessed with better. Learn more at www.WabtecCorp.com.
